The ability to utilize Apple’s in-car entertainment system on devices running Google’s mobile operating system represents a convergence of technologies. This functionality allows Android users to experience a user interface and feature set designed for Apple devices directly within their vehicle’s infotainment system. For example, connecting an Android phone to a compatible car unit effectively mirrors the CarPlay environment.
This capability bridges a technological divide, offering users access to a familiar and streamlined experience regardless of their primary mobile platform. Benefits include increased convenience, access to preferred applications, and potentially enhanced safety through voice-controlled navigation and communication. Historically, such cross-platform compatibility has been a significant driver in the adoption of technologies in the automotive sector.
The following sections will delve into the methods by which this integration is achieved, exploring both official solutions and alternative approaches. It will also address considerations related to hardware compatibility, potential limitations, and the evolving landscape of in-car entertainment systems.
1. Connectivity Methods
Connectivity methods form the foundational layer for enabling Apple CarPlay functionality on Android-based systems. The chosen method directly influences the performance, stability, and overall user experience of accessing CarPlay features on a non-Apple device.
-
Wired USB Connection
A direct connection via USB cable represents one of the most common and reliable methods. This approach typically ensures a stable data transfer rate, minimizing latency and enabling seamless execution of CarPlay functions. Many aftermarket CarPlay adapters and Android head units designed to support CarPlay rely on a wired USB connection. However, the need for a physical connection can be less convenient than wireless options.
-
Wireless Connection via Bluetooth and Wi-Fi
Wireless connectivity, often utilizing a combination of Bluetooth for initial pairing and Wi-Fi for data transfer, offers increased convenience and a cleaner aesthetic within the vehicle. This method eliminates the need for physical cables, reducing clutter and improving user accessibility. However, wireless connections can be susceptible to interference and may exhibit higher latency compared to wired options, potentially impacting performance.
-
Aftermarket Adapters
The introduction of aftermarket adapters has enabled connectivity when direct compatibility is absent. Adapters plug into the USB port of an Android head unit and create a bridge for CarPlay. These often rely on a combination of hardware and software solutions to emulate the environment CarPlay requires. Although widespread, these methods bring reliability issues such as lag and random disconnections. Some adapters require specific Android versions for compatibility
The selection of an appropriate connectivity method is critical to achieving a satisfactory CarPlay experience on an Android system. Wired connections prioritize stability and performance, while wireless options emphasize convenience. The growing popularity of aftermarket adapters attempts to bridge the gap for older systems, but the performance consistency of these devices remains a key consideration for users.
2. Hardware Compatibility
Hardware compatibility represents a critical determinant in the successful implementation of Apple CarPlay functionality on Android devices or head units. The underlying hardware infrastructure must meet specific requirements to ensure seamless operation and prevent performance bottlenecks, directly impacting the user experience.
-
Processor and Memory
The processing power and available memory of the Android device or head unit significantly influence CarPlay’s performance. CarPlay requires sufficient processing capabilities to render graphics, handle audio streams, and execute applications smoothly. Insufficient processing power can lead to lag, delayed responses, and a degraded user experience. Similarly, adequate RAM is essential for multitasking and preventing application crashes. Android head units with older or less powerful processors and limited RAM may struggle to provide a satisfactory CarPlay experience.
-
Screen Resolution and Display Technology
The resolution and quality of the display screen directly impact the visual clarity and overall appeal of the CarPlay interface. CarPlay is designed to be viewed on high-resolution displays; therefore, low-resolution screens can result in pixelation, blurring, and a less immersive experience. Additionally, display technologies like IPS (In-Plane Switching) offer wider viewing angles and better color reproduction, enhancing visibility and usability for both the driver and passengers. The display must also support touch input with sufficient accuracy and responsiveness for seamless interaction with CarPlay’s touch-based interface.
-
Audio Output and Connectivity
The audio system of the Android device or head unit must be compatible with CarPlay’s audio output requirements. This includes support for standard audio codecs and protocols to ensure proper audio playback through the vehicle’s speakers. The audio system should also offer clear and distortion-free sound reproduction for music, navigation prompts, and phone calls. Furthermore, the device must support Bluetooth connectivity for wireless CarPlay functionality and microphone integration for voice commands and hands-free calling.
-
USB Port Compatibility and Power Delivery
For wired CarPlay connections, the Android device or head unit must have a compatible USB port that supports data transfer and power delivery. The USB port must provide sufficient power to charge the connected iPhone while in use. Incompatible or underpowered USB ports can lead to connection issues, slow charging, and potential data transfer errors. The USB port should also adhere to relevant industry standards to ensure reliable communication between the Android device and the iPhone.
These hardware considerations are vital for a positive integration. Inadequate attention to processor capabilities, display quality, audio output, or USB compatibility can result in a subpar CarPlay experience on Android systems, undermining the intended benefits of the integration. Therefore, careful evaluation of hardware specifications is essential before attempting to implement CarPlay on an Android platform.
3. Software Adaptation
Software adaptation is a cornerstone for enabling Apple CarPlay on Android-based systems. The inherent incompatibility between the iOS-centric CarPlay environment and the Android operating system necessitates the use of software solutions that can bridge this divide. This adaptation is not merely about superficial interface changes; it involves complex processes that translate communication protocols, manage data streams, and emulate the expected behavior of iOS devices within the Android framework. For example, applications designed for CarPlay often rely on specific iOS libraries and APIs that do not natively exist on Android. Software adaptation solutions must therefore provide substitutes or workarounds to ensure these applications function correctly.
Several approaches to software adaptation exist, ranging from aftermarket applications to customized firmware for Android head units. Aftermarket applications often act as intermediaries, intercepting and translating data between the iPhone and the Android system. Custom firmware, on the other hand, attempts to create a more integrated environment by modifying the core Android operating system to better support CarPlay functionality. These approaches differ in their level of invasiveness and the degree to which they can successfully replicate the native CarPlay experience. For instance, a poorly adapted system may exhibit latency issues, compatibility problems with certain CarPlay apps, or instability during operation. Consider the example of navigation applications. The software adaptation layer must accurately relay GPS data from the Android system to the CarPlay interface to ensure precise routing. Failure to do so can lead to inaccurate navigation, diminishing the usability of the system.
In conclusion, the success of implementing Apple CarPlay on Android hinges critically on the effectiveness of software adaptation. The challenges associated with this adaptation include maintaining compatibility with evolving versions of both iOS and Android, ensuring a stable and responsive user experience, and addressing potential security vulnerabilities. The ongoing development and refinement of software adaptation techniques are therefore essential for realizing the full potential of cross-platform in-car entertainment.
4. App availability
App availability constitutes a crucial factor influencing the usability and overall value proposition of integrating Apple CarPlay functionality into Android-based systems. The range of applications accessible through the CarPlay interface directly determines the features and services available to the user within the vehicle.
-
Core CarPlay Applications
CarPlay inherently supports a specific set of applications, primarily focusing on navigation, communication, and entertainment. These typically include Apple Maps (or Google Maps, Waze, if permitted by the user), Apple Music (or Spotify, Pandora), Phone, and Messages. The consistent availability and functionality of these core apps are paramount to delivering a baseline CarPlay experience within the Android environment. Any limitations or incompatibilities with these core apps significantly diminish the value of the integration.
-
Third-Party Application Support
The breadth of third-party applications supported by CarPlay expands its utility beyond the core functionalities. Music streaming services, podcast players, audiobook platforms, and other specialized apps contribute to a richer and more personalized in-car experience. The compatibility and performance of these third-party applications on an Android-based CarPlay system are directly dependent on the quality of the software adaptation and the adherence to CarPlay’s developer guidelines. Limited third-party support restricts user choice and potentially reduces the appeal of the integration.
-
Geographic Restrictions and Licensing
App availability can be subject to geographic restrictions and licensing agreements. Some applications may not be available in certain regions due to regulatory constraints or distribution agreements. Furthermore, the use of certain CarPlay-enabled apps may require subscription fees or in-app purchases. Such restrictions can impact the accessibility and usability of CarPlay features for users in specific locations or with particular service preferences. The implications of these factors must be transparently communicated to the end-user to manage expectations.
-
Application Updates and Compatibility
Maintaining compatibility with ongoing application updates is an ongoing challenge for Android systems implementing CarPlay. As Apple releases updates to iOS and CarPlay, app developers may modify their applications to take advantage of new features or address compatibility issues. The software adaptation layer on the Android side must be continuously updated to ensure that these changes do not break compatibility or introduce new bugs. Failure to keep pace with application updates can lead to degraded performance, application crashes, or the complete loss of functionality for certain apps.
These multifaceted aspects of app availability collectively define the user’s perception of successfully integrating Apple CarPlay with an Android system. A limited, unreliable, or geographically restricted app ecosystem undermines the core value of CarPlay, potentially leading to user dissatisfaction. Conversely, a robust, compatible, and well-maintained app selection enhances the overall experience and strengthens the appeal of utilizing CarPlay within an Android environment.
5. User Interface
The user interface (UI) serves as the primary point of interaction between an individual and the technological system designed to emulate Apple CarPlay functionality within an Android environment. Its design and implementation directly influence the user’s ability to effectively access and utilize the features offered. The fidelity with which the CarPlay UI is replicated is paramount to providing a familiar and intuitive experience.
-
Visual Fidelity
The visual replication of the CarPlay interface, including icons, fonts, color schemes, and layout, is critical for user recognition and ease of navigation. A high degree of visual similarity reduces the learning curve and allows users accustomed to CarPlay to quickly adapt to its implementation on an Android system. Discrepancies in visual elements can lead to confusion and frustration, undermining the seamless experience that is intended. For example, subtle variations in icon design or text rendering can disrupt the user’s intuitive understanding of the interface.
-
Touch Responsiveness and Latency
The responsiveness of the touchscreen interface is a key determinant of the user experience. Minimal latency between a touch input and the corresponding action on the screen is essential for fluid and natural interaction. Delays or unresponsiveness can make the system feel sluggish and unresponsive, hindering usability. Consider the act of scrolling through a list of songs; noticeable lag between finger movement and screen updates degrades the overall experience. The underlying hardware and software adaptation must be optimized to minimize latency and ensure a responsive touch interface.
-
Voice Control Integration
CarPlay relies heavily on voice control for hands-free operation, allowing users to interact with the system without diverting their attention from driving. Seamless integration of voice control functionality is therefore crucial for safe and convenient use. The accuracy and speed of voice recognition, as well as the system’s ability to understand natural language commands, directly impact the effectiveness of this feature. A robust voice control system enables users to make calls, send messages, navigate to destinations, and control music playback without manual input.
-
Information Architecture and Navigation
The organization and structure of information within the CarPlay interface directly impact the ease with which users can find and access desired features. A well-designed information architecture ensures that commonly used functions are readily accessible and that the navigation flow is intuitive and logical. Confusing or convoluted navigation can lead to frustration and wasted time. For instance, grouping related functions together and providing clear visual cues can improve the user’s ability to quickly locate and utilize specific features within the CarPlay environment.
These facets of the user interface collectively contribute to the overall user experience of implementing Apple CarPlay on Android systems. The successful replication of CarPlay’s UI, coupled with responsive touch controls, reliable voice control integration, and an intuitive information architecture, is essential for providing a seamless and satisfying in-car entertainment experience. Discrepancies in any of these areas can detract from the value of the integration and hinder the user’s ability to effectively utilize the system.
6. Potential limitations
The integration of Apple CarPlay functionality into Android-based systems, while offering certain benefits, is inherently subject to several limitations. These limitations stem from the fundamental differences between the iOS and Android operating systems, as well as the hardware and software adaptations required to bridge this gap. These limitations can directly impact the user experience, functionality, and stability of the integrated system.
-
Software Compatibility Issues
Discrepancies between iOS and Android can lead to software incompatibility issues. Applications designed for CarPlay rely on specific iOS libraries and APIs not natively available on Android. While software adaptations attempt to bridge this gap, they may not always perfectly replicate the intended behavior, resulting in bugs, crashes, or limited functionality. The Android system must also be able to translate data that is read correctly. Applications might behave erratically because of this mismatch.
-
Hardware Performance Constraints
The performance of CarPlay on Android systems is often constrained by the underlying hardware capabilities of the Android device or head unit. Insufficient processing power, limited memory, or an inadequate display can result in lag, slow response times, and a degraded user experience. The visual interface may suffer from graphical issues with screen resolution. These constraints can limit the extent to which the system can smoothly and reliably emulate the native CarPlay experience.
-
Dependence on Aftermarket Solutions
Achieving CarPlay functionality on Android often relies on aftermarket applications or adapters, which may introduce their own limitations. These solutions may not be officially supported by Apple or Google, raising concerns about security, stability, and long-term compatibility. These adapters may become obsolete with newer versions of Android. The reliability of these products is also variable.
-
Limited Feature Parity
Despite efforts to replicate the CarPlay experience, complete feature parity with native CarPlay installations is often difficult to achieve. Certain advanced features or functionalities may not be fully supported or may operate with reduced efficiency. This is generally due to underlying APIs. An example might be Siri voice commands not working correctly due to lack of full compatibility.
These potential limitations must be carefully considered when evaluating the feasibility and desirability of implementing Apple CarPlay on an Android system. While the integration may offer a degree of convenience and access to CarPlay features, it is important to recognize that the experience may not be as seamless, reliable, or feature-rich as that of a native CarPlay installation. Users should weigh the benefits against the potential drawbacks before making a decision.
7. Security Implications
The integration of Apple CarPlay functionality into Android-based systems introduces notable security implications. Bridging two distinct operating systems necessitates careful management of data flow and system permissions, potentially exposing vulnerabilities that could compromise user privacy and system integrity.
-
Data Interception and Modification
Software adaptations employed to enable CarPlay on Android can act as intermediaries, intercepting data transmitted between the iPhone and the vehicle’s head unit. This interception presents opportunities for malicious actors to access sensitive information, such as contacts, messages, location data, and even authentication credentials. Modified software or compromised adapters could alter data streams, potentially leading to unauthorized actions or the dissemination of false information. For instance, falsified GPS data could misguide the driver, or manipulated payment information could result in fraudulent transactions.
-
Compromised System Permissions
To function correctly, aftermarket CarPlay solutions on Android often require elevated system permissions, granting them access to sensitive resources and functionalities. These permissions may extend beyond what is strictly necessary for CarPlay emulation, creating a potential attack surface for malware or spyware. A compromised application with excessive permissions could access user data, monitor communications, or even remotely control aspects of the Android device. This is further complicated when the Android system itself runs on an older, unsupported version with known vulnerabilities.
-
Untrusted Sources and Software
Many CarPlay implementations on Android rely on unofficial or untrusted software sources. Downloading and installing applications from these sources increases the risk of installing malware, viruses, or other malicious software. These malicious applications could masquerade as legitimate CarPlay enablers, tricking users into granting them access to their systems and data. Furthermore, the lack of official validation or security audits for these applications makes it difficult to assess their trustworthiness.
-
Firmware Vulnerabilities and Exploits
In cases where CarPlay integration involves modifying the Android head unit’s firmware, the risk of introducing vulnerabilities increases significantly. Modified firmware may contain security flaws or backdoors that can be exploited by attackers. Furthermore, the process of flashing custom firmware can be risky, potentially bricking the device or exposing it to malware. Unauthorized access to the firmware could enable attackers to remotely control the head unit, access vehicle systems, or compromise sensitive data stored on the device.
These security implications underscore the inherent risks associated with integrating Apple CarPlay into Android environments. While such integration may offer functional benefits, users must exercise caution and carefully evaluate the potential security risks before implementing these solutions. Employing robust security measures, such as installing reputable antivirus software, carefully reviewing app permissions, and only downloading software from trusted sources, can help mitigate some of these risks. The potential for compromised data and system integrity remains a critical consideration.
Frequently Asked Questions
This section addresses common inquiries and clarifies misconceptions surrounding the implementation of Apple CarPlay functionality on Android-based systems.
Question 1: Is native Apple CarPlay directly installable on Android operating systems?
No, native Apple CarPlay is not directly installable on Android operating systems. CarPlay is designed to operate within the iOS environment. Implementing CarPlay functionality on Android requires software adaptations and often, additional hardware.
Question 2: What is the primary method for using Apple CarPlay on an Android head unit?
The most common method involves the use of aftermarket CarPlay adapters. These devices connect to the Android head unit via USB and act as a bridge, emulating the necessary protocols for CarPlay to function.
Question 3: Does utilizing Apple CarPlay on Android present any security risks?
Yes, integrating CarPlay on Android introduces potential security risks. Aftermarket adapters and software adaptations may compromise data privacy or system integrity due to vulnerabilities or unauthorized access.
Question 4: Will all Apple CarPlay applications function seamlessly on Android systems?
Not all CarPlay applications function seamlessly on Android. Compatibility varies depending on the software adaptation and hardware capabilities. Some applications may exhibit limited functionality or instability.
Question 5: Is a wired USB connection always necessary for Apple CarPlay to operate on Android?
While wired USB connections are common, wireless CarPlay adapters for Android systems do exist. However, the reliability and performance of wireless connections may vary depending on the specific hardware and software configuration.
Question 6: Are software updates readily available for Apple CarPlay emulators on Android?
Software updates for CarPlay emulators on Android are typically dependent on the aftermarket adapter manufacturer or software developer. The frequency and availability of updates can be inconsistent, potentially leading to compatibility issues over time.
In summary, while integrating Apple CarPlay into Android systems is possible, it is crucial to acknowledge the inherent limitations, security considerations, and potential compatibility challenges associated with this cross-platform integration.
The following section will explore alternatives to achieving similar in-car entertainment functionalities without directly implementing Apple CarPlay on Android.
Tips
Careful consideration is advised when pursuing the integration of Apple CarPlay functionality within an Android environment. Optimization strategies are crucial for mitigating potential limitations and ensuring a satisfactory user experience.
Tip 1: Verify Hardware Compatibility: Before purchasing any adapter or software, confirm that the Android head unit meets the minimum hardware requirements. Insufficient processing power or limited RAM can severely impact performance. Refer to manufacturer specifications for compatibility details.
Tip 2: Prioritize Reputable Sources: Acquire software adaptations and CarPlay adapters from established and trustworthy vendors. Avoid downloading applications from unofficial sources, as these may pose security risks.
Tip 3: Implement Network Security Measures: Secure the vehicle’s Wi-Fi network, if applicable, with a strong password. Regularly update the Android system’s security settings to protect against potential vulnerabilities arising from network access.
Tip 4: Regularly Check Application Permissions: Carefully review the permissions requested by CarPlay emulator applications. Grant only the permissions necessary for core functionality to minimize the potential for data access and privacy breaches.
Tip 5: Monitor System Performance: Observe the Android system’s performance after installing the CarPlay emulator. Excessive battery drain, overheating, or system instability may indicate compatibility issues or underlying problems requiring attention.
Tip 6: Stay Informed on Software Updates: Maintain awareness of software updates for both the CarPlay emulator and the Android operating system. These updates often include critical security patches and performance improvements that are essential for optimal operation.
Adherence to these recommendations can enhance the functionality, security, and overall satisfaction associated with Apple CarPlay on Android.
The succeeding final section offers a summarization of the central arguments put forth and offers conclusive ideas.
Conclusion
The integration of Apple CarPlay on Android systems represents a complex convergence of disparate technologies. This exploration has highlighted that while achieving functional compatibility is possible, it is often accompanied by inherent limitations, security considerations, and potential performance constraints. Software adaptation techniques, hardware compatibility factors, and user interface considerations collectively determine the overall viability and user experience of such integrations.
Ultimately, informed decision-making is paramount. Individuals considering implementing Apple CarPlay on Android should meticulously weigh the potential benefits against the associated risks. As in-car entertainment systems continue to evolve, a comprehensive understanding of both the technical intricacies and the security implications will be essential for navigating the increasingly interconnected automotive landscape.